Marienberg Devices Germany make high-end analog synthesizer modules, which are not just fun for making music, but also for use as reference devices for demonstration purposes. So apart from looking at the VCF's specific features, we will also learn about typical analog filter behaviours and use cases, which are applicable to filters of other manufacturers and formats as well (e.g. AE Modular, Serge Modular, Eurorack, dotcom Modular, etc.)."
